I have 4 hens but I'm really only attached to one, its an easter egger that we raised as a day old chick. i want to get rid of the other three. would it be wrong keeping just one hen alone?
 
I had it happen that I lost two of my three hens close together and we hadn't planned on getting more. I hadn't found BYC yet!

Poor Rocky would spend all her time at our sliding glass door looking in for company. And yet she isn't a friendly chicken. We got two pullets and she was much happier. Now she has 14 friends to hang around with including roosters for the first time in her 10 years. She has a blast pushing them around!
 
Can you keep 1, sure. If you want to keep 2 why not.
But, like the posts said prior to your 2nd question, chickens are a flock mentality. You as the human can do as you please. Some folks even have house chickens. So, its up to you what you want to do.
